Is Kuwait warmer or hotter than Corona, California?

On average across the year, yes, Kuwait is hotter than Corona, California . Kuwait has an average temperature of 29°C/84°F and Corona, California has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F.

Kuwait's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 48°C/118°F, which is hotter than Corona, California's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 35°C/95°F).

Does Kuwait have more rain than Corona, California?

On average across the year, no, Kuwait has less rain than Corona, California. Kuwait has an average annual rainfall of 62mm and Corona, California has an average annual rainfall of 280mm.

Kuwait's wettest month is November, with an average monthly rainfall of 20mm, which is drier than Corona, California's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 70mm).
